Madison Residents Vote Up or Down on Budget Tuesday

The combined town and schools fiscal year 2019-'20 budget comes to $84,788,943, a slightly higher than 2 percent hike over last year.

MADISON, CT - Polls will be open from 6 a.m. to 8 p.m. Tuesday as Madison holds its annual budget referendum. The combined town and schools fiscal year 2019-’20 budget comes to $84,788,943, an increase in spending over last year of $1,721,742 or 2.07 percent.

  • District 1 votes at the Madison Senior Center, located at 29 Bradley Road. District 1 includes all registered voters who live at properties on the even numbered side of Green Hill Road and South.
  • District 2 votes at Brown Middle School, located at 980 Durham Road. District 2 includes all registered voters who live at properties on the odd numbered side of Green Hill Road and North.
